RV parks and campgrounds also consider length to be a major component of your RV. If you’re full timing, you may want to consider a bigger rig, but if you only plan on taking your RV out on the weekends, a small rig should work fine. Not only are many smaller travel trailers well-equipped, but they can bring you real opportunities to get close to your partner or loved one. While you may be thinking a longer rig will give you more amenities, small and lightweight travel trailers are being given all the bells and whistles you would normally expect in far larger trailers. For your own safety, while towing on the road, a shorter travel trailer is always a better option. Towing a level trailer is one thing and having a trailer you can safely drive down the road is another. The overall length of your travel trailer greatly affects your ability to tow carefully and safely.
